The suv Daewoo Winstorm 2007 - 2011 year modification 3.2 AT (227 hp) 4x4

Engine

Engine type petrol
Engine capacity, cm³ 3195
Boost type No
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 227 / 167 at 5750
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 297 at —
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 6
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system distributed injection
Compression ratio 10
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 89.9 × 84

General information

Brand country South Korea
Car class J
Number of doors 5

Performance indicators

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ined 16.4 / 8.6 / 12
Fuel type Super (95)
Maximum speed, km/h 204
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s 8.8

Sizes in mm

Length 4635
Width 1850
Height 1720
Wheelbase 2705
Ground clearance 200
Front track width 1562
Rear track width 1572
Wheel size 215 / 70 / R16

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disc
Rear brakes disc

Transmission

Transmission automatic
Number of gears 5
Drive type full

Volume and weight

Gross weight, kg 2440
Fuel tank capacity, l 65
Curb weight, kg 1810
Trunk volume min/max, l 465 / 930

Daewoo Winstorm: A Reliable SUV for Adventure Seekers

The Daewoo Winstorm, a South Korean SUV produced between 2007 and 2011, is a versatile and robust vehicle designed for both urban and off-road driving. With its 3.2-liter petrol engine and automatic transmission, this SUV offers a blend of power, comfort, and practicality. Its full-time all-wheel-drive system ensures excellent traction in various driving conditions, making it a reliable choice for adventure enthusiasts.

Performance and Efficiency

Equipped with a 3.2-liter inline-6 engine, the Daewoo Winstorm delivers 227 horsepower and 297 Nm of torque, providing ample power for both city commutes and highway cruising. The SUV acc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 8.8 seconds, reaching a top speed of 204 km/h. While its fuel consumption is higher in urban settings (16.4 l/100 km), it performs more efficiently on highways (8.6 l/100 km), with a combined consumption of 12 l/100 km. This makes it a suitable option for long-distance travel.

Design and Dimensions

The Winstorm boasts a spacious and practical design, with a length of 4635 mm, a width of 1850 mm, and a height of 1720 mm. Its 2705 mm wheelbase ensures a comfortable ride, while the 200 mm ground clearance allows for tackling rough terrains with ease. The SUV features a 5-door configuration, offering ample space for passengers and cargo. The trunk volume ranges from 465 liters to 930 liters, making it ideal for family trips or outdoor adventures.
